Archer's Voice by Mia Sheridan

5.0

I can't even begin to describe this book. This beautiful story between Bree and Archer had me at the edge of a rollercoaster of emotions. A damaged heroine arrives to a small town to run away from a brutal event, finds herself mesmerized by the mystery surrounding Archer Hale, the town's most reserved and misunderstood boy. Archer lives in it own world, away from everyone immersed in handy work without communicating with anyone. As curious Bree trespasses his world, they will create a true friendship that evolved into love. The pain they both carry will make the relationship difficult, full of doubts and also hope. This is what love truly is. Archer's self-growth is also key for the story. It is the best read of my 2023 so far.
